We are seeking an experienced Manhattan WMOS Functional Lead to join our team in the Netherlands. In this role, you will be responsible for implementing, optimizing, and maintaining Manhattan Associates’ Warehouse Management for Open Systems (WMOS) to support seamless warehouse operations. You will ensure accuracy in how inventory is received, moved, picked, shipped, and reported. As a key player, you will collaborate with cross-functional teams—including operations, SAP, and integration specialists—to validate WMOS functionality, resolve system or data misalignments, and provide innovative solutions to complex business challenges.
Job Responsibility:
Validate that WMOS behaves correctly according to operational rules and integration specifications
Analyze inventory snapshots and discrepancy reports to identify and resolve issues
Collaborate with SAP and integration teams to address root causes of misalignments
Lead functional design, configuration, and testing activities for WMOS
Support training, go-live, and post-implementation stabilization
Monitor WMOS performance and drive continuous process improvement initiatives
Act as a subject matter expert (SME) for WMOS functionality, guiding both business and IT stakeholders
Requirements:
10+ years of hands-on experience implementing or supporting Manhattan WMOS solutions
Strong understanding of warehouse operations, including receiving, picking, packing, and shipping
Certification in Manhattan WMOS or related modules preferred
Experience with SCI (Supply Chain Intelligence) for reporting and BI
Proven background in high-volume warehouse environments, eCommerce, or 3PL operations
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with the ability to resolve complex issues
Excellent communication, documentation, and stakeholder management skills
Ability to adapt in a fast-paced, global, and dynamic environment
Bachelor’s degree in Supply Chain Management, Information Systems, or a related field
